Historical Background of Cabo Verde National Festival

Origins of São Vicente Carnival

São Vicente Carnival traces its roots back to the 19th century when Cabo Verdean slaves would gather and express their cultural identity through music, dance, and costumes. The festival evolved over time, incorporating elements of African, European, and Latin American cultures, resulting in a unique and captivating celebration.

Preparations and Festivities on Cabo Verde National Festival

Months Prior

Months before the carnival, the island of São Vicente comes alive with preparations. Community groups, known as “trupes,” spend countless hours designing and creating elaborate costumes and floats. The air is filled with anticipation and excitement as the entire island eagerly awaits the grand event.

Parade and Music

The heart of São Vicente Carnival lies in its vibrant parade and music. Colorful processions wind through the streets, accompanied by the pulsating rhythms of traditional Cabo Verdean music. The joyful sounds of batuque, funaná, and coladeira reverberate through the air, captivating both locals and visitors alike.

Traditional Costumes

A highlight of the carnival is the mesmerizing display of traditional costumes. Participants don exquisitely crafted outfits adorned with feathers, sequins, and vibrant colors, reflecting the diverse cultural influences of Cabo Verde. Each costume tells a unique story, showcasing the creativity and craftsmanship of the Cabo Verdean people.

Street Parties

Throughout the carnival, the streets of São Vicente transform into a carnival lover’s paradise. Street parties, known as “burburinhos,” fill the air with infectious energy as revelers dance, sing, and celebrate. The jovial atmosphere and spontaneous nature of these gatherings make them a favorite among both locals and tourists.

Music Competitions

São Vicente Carnival also hosts lively music competitions, providing a stage for talented musicians to showcase their skills. Bands and solo artists compete in various categories, including batuque, morna, and coladeira, captivating the audience with their soul-stirring performances. The music competitions add an extra layer of excitement and friendly rivalry to the carnival.

FAQs

  1. When does São Vicente Carnival take place?

São Vicente Carnival typically takes place in February, leading up to the Lenten season.

  • How long does the carnival last?

The carnival festivities usually span several days, with the main events concentrated over a weekend.
